SPEED CONTROLLER INSTALLATION

1.
Install controller (6) on the two self-tapping screws (3). Install third self-tapping screw (3) and tighten to 5.5
ft·lb (7.5 N·m) (Figure 13-6, Page 13-8).
2.
Connect the 16-pin connector, 4-pin connector, and spade connectors to the controller (6).
3.
Connect the the heavy gauge wires to the controller (6) per the electrical schematics. See Wiring Diagrams on
page 12-4. Tighten terminal screws (1) on the controller to 108 in·lb (12.2 N·m).
4.
Return controller (6) to its original location. (Figure 13-6, Page 13-8).
5.
Place the Run/Tow switch in the TOW position and connect the batteries. See Connecting the Batteries –
Electric Vehicles on page 1-4.
6.
Place the Run/Tow switch in the RUN position.
7.
If vehicle is equipped with the Guardian SVC system, perform the following additional steps for proper setup.
7.1.
Connect a CDT to the CDT port on the vehicle.
7.2.
Select Program, Settings, Control Mode and set the value to 1.
7.3.
Select Program, Settings, Anti Tamper and set the value to 0.
7.4.
Select Program, Vehicle ID, Vehicle S/N and enter the last six digits of the vehicle serial number.
NOTE: The speed for scrolling values may be increased by utilizing the bookmark keys (yellow buttons) in combination
with the data inc/dec key (+/-).
7.5.
Select Program, Vehicle ID, Vehicle Decal and enter the number on the Vehicle Number Decal.
7.6.
Select Program, Vehicle ID, Vehicle Date of Manufacture and enter the number on the model year and
week from the vehicle serial number.
